Hi, i am working 2d butadyne oxygen combustion with reactingFoam solver, i am using 6 step reaction mechanism but i have read various articles on unit conversion and i think i may be doing something wrong. I know that openfoam uses kcal mol kelvin, but when I calculate the "A-beta Ta" coefficients accordingly, my results are different than expected.
Is there something I missed? How should I do unit conversions? |
